WebbTraining for carers, both foster and kinship, is a significant way we can provide support. Pre-service training is compulsory for all foster carer applicants. Kinship carers are not required to attend training, however, they are encouraged to attend foster carer training to enhance their knowledge and skills. WebbSkills to Foster training. After your visit, if everyone is in agreement to proceed, we'll ask you to complete a registration of interest form. You'll then be invited to a Skills to Foster training course which is usually run by social workers and local foster carers. You'll learn more about fostering and the support and benefits we offer. WebbFoster Care allows children the chance to thrive in a safe, secure, loving and caring home environment with foster carers. The children and young people placed with foster carers are from a diverse range of backgrounds and will display different behaviour depending upon their various experiences.
Webb14 apr. 2014 · Birth parents want involvement, information and understanding – in other words, empathy and respect – from social workers (Schofield et al, 2011). Active listening and honest communication will promote this understanding. Social workers have to balance the changing needs of children, foster carers, adopters and birth families.
